for all your help. Progress report ? but it has been 10 weeks since my PEUC application.
As you advised, I called Oahu Office for the first time to ask if it was glitch about Claim Certification not being done ( 11/30 ), instead of calling the call center before that. I was told that it was due to Overpayment and to wait for the Examiner to call me back. I kept calling the Overpayment Office that week, but never got through. I called the Oahu Office again the next week and asked if they could raise my Priority to the Examiner, but they said the only way was to contact Overpayment. I faxed the Overpayment Office on 12/7, but I have not received any letter or phone call yet.
In case of Overpayment, I think the process is to cancel PEUC, use the Overpayment amount for normal UI, and then reapply for PEUC, but as I mentioned above, Claim Certification is not possible, so I am still in Pending status. I am worried if I can reapply for PEUC if the year passes.
You mentioned in another thread that you can "also confirm what to do about the EB20 application if we are still waiting for PEUC approval in January", so I will refer to that in the future as well.

Like Shoyu11, I guess many applicants who found overpayment at PEUC are rushing to the Overpayment counter. I saw a past case about Overpayment and I will write about it later in the "PEUC Unemployment Insurance 13 Week Program" Topic.

From the case study, it seems to me that in Shoyu11's case, it would be a good idea to try calling the Overpayment office every day and at the same time wait for them to call you back. Also, try a letter by mail since mail also seems to work.

The Examiner who helped me interpret the EB20 question said that they are discussing it in the UI office before giving a formal response about waiting for PEUC approval after January. The responsible team has also contacted the UI Director, and since this is the first EB20 for the UI office, I think they are systematically exploring the issue.
